A daily dose of antiretroviral medication lowered the risk of contracting HIV by more than 40% among men who have sex with men, according to a study published Tuesday in the New England Journal of Medicine, the New York Times reports. The results of the study -- nicknamed iPrEx -- "are the best news in the AIDS field in years" and "could change the battle" against HIV/AIDS, according to the Times (McNeil, New York Times, 11/23). Experts suspect the medication will be successful in other groups but caution that it must be tested first...
